Need some help from the Lo Bro's. I just installed some street slammer and my bike is not starting. I had the tank off and after reassembly I'm not getting the pre start check. Usually When you turn on the ignition you get the pre flight check for a couple of seconds. Right now I get lights, console, and she tries to start but no usual pre start check. What the hell did I miss or need to do? Please help!!! So close but so ride.

Did you take the wires out from their housings? and are you sure you put them back in the correct order? If when you flip the "run" switch, and you don't hear the fuel pump turn on, that's the first thing I'd check.. that 1) the wires are in the correct order, and 2) they're making a good contact to the connection under the tank.
